I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E WESTERN DISTRICT OF NORTH CAROLINA ASHEVILLE DIVISION CIVIL CASE NO. 1:13-cv-000325-MR GAIA HERBS, INC. Plaintiff, vs. FIVE V’S PTY., LTD. and DREAMZ PTY., LTD., Defendants. 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ORDER THIS MATTER is before the Court on the Plaintiff’s Consent Motion to Modify the Pretrial Order and Case Management Plan [Doc. 26]. The Plaintiff seeks a 90-day extension of the remaining pretrial deadlines, with the exception of the trial date. The Defendants do not oppose the Plaintiff’s request. [Doc. 26]. The requested extension would not allow the Court sufficient time to address any dispositive motions prior to the trial date. Accordingly, the Plaintiff’s request for a 90-day extension of all pretrial deadlines is denied. The Court will allow, however, a 30-day extension of these deadlines. IT IS, THEREFORE, ORDERED that the Consent Motion to Modify the Pretrial Order and Case Management Plan [Doc. 26] is GRANTED IN PART, and the following deadlines set forth in the Pretrial Order and Case Management Plan are hereby AMENDED as follows: Plaintiff Expert Report: March 2, 2015 Defendant Expert Report: April 1, 2015 Discovery: May 1, 2015 Mediation: May 15, 2015 Motions: June 1, 2015 IT IS SO ORDERED. Signed: November 20, 2014
